From d3bd3630ee9599f1bdbc71e0efb3d3b21ee0100e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?latyas=28=E6=87=92=29?= Date: Fri, 15 May 2015 10:16:35 +0800 Subject: [PATCH] max-age may be not digits --- requests/cookies.py |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/requests/cookies.py b/requests/cookies.py index 8ca64260..c0865106 100644 --- a/requests/cookies.py +++ b/requests/cookies.py @@ -415,7 +415,10 @@ def morsel_to_cookie(morsel): expires = None if morsel['max-age']: - expires = time.time() + float(morsel['max-age']) + try: + expires = time.time() + float(morsel['max-age']) + except ValueError: + pass elif morsel['expires']: time_template = '%a, %d-%b-%Y %H:%M:%S GMT' expires = time.mktime(